Chitwan Terai

Lush tropical forests home to one-horned rhinos, Bengal tigers, and rich Tharu culture. Experience the warm, fertile flatlands of southern Nepal.

ELEVATION RANGE100m - 800m
IDEAL SEASONSOctober to March
TRAIL GRADEEasy

PRACTICAL GUIDES

Travel Resources & Safety

Permits & Regulations

Chitwan National Park entry fee is NPR 2,000 per day for foreigners. Professional guides must accompany any walking safaris.

Altitude Safety

Low elevation (under 800m). No altitude sickness risk. Malaria prevention, bug sprays, and sun hats are highly recommended.

Essential Gear

Neutral-colored clothing (avoid bright colors which scare animals), mosquito repellent, binoculars, sun hat, and light cotton layers.

Access & Logistics

Accessed by a 20-min flight from Kathmandu to Bharatpur Airport, followed by a 40-min drive, or a 5-6 hour road trip.
